# AVSession Kit(音视频播控服务) - ArkTS API - @ohos.multimedia.avsession (媒体会话管理) - [模块描述](arkts-apis-avsession.md) - [Functions](arkts-apis-avsession-f.md) - [Class (AVCastPickerHelper)](arkts-apis-avsession-AVCastPickerHelper.md) - [Interface (AVCastController)](arkts-apis-avsession-AVCastController.md) - [Interface (AVSession)](arkts-apis-avsession-AVSession.md) - [Interface (AVSessionController)](arkts-apis-avsession-AVSessionController.md) - [Interfaces (其他)](arkts-apis-avsession-i.md) - [Enums](arkts-apis-avsession-e.md) - [Types](arkts-apis-avsession-t.md) - [@ohos.multimedia.avCastPickerParam (投播组件参数)](js-apis-avCastPickerParam.md) - [@ohos.app.ability.MediaControlExtensionAbility (播控扩展能力)(系统接口)](js-apis-app-ability-MediaControlExtensionAbility-sys.md) - [@ohos.multimedia.avsession (媒体会话管理)(系统接口)](js-apis-avsession-sys.md) - application - [MediaControlExtensionContext (播控扩展能力上下文)(系统接口)](js-apis-inner-application-MediaControlExtensionContext-sys.md) - ArkTS组件 - [@ohos.multimedia.avCastPicker (投播组件)](ohos-multimedia-avcastpicker.md) - [@ohos.multimedia.avInputCastPicker(录音设备选择组件)](ohos-multimedia-avinputcastpicker.md) - C API - 模块 - [OHAVSession](capi-ohavsession.md) - 头文件 - [native_avmetadata.h](capi-native-avmetadata-h.md) - [native_avsession.h](capi-native-avsession-h.md) - [native_avsession_errors.h](capi-native-avsession-errors-h.md) - 结构体 - [OH_AVMetadataBuilderStruct](capi-ohavsession-oh-avmetadatabuilderstruct.md) - [OH_AVMetadataStruct](capi-ohavsession-oh-avmetadatastruct.md) - [AVSession_PlaybackPosition](capi-ohavsession-avsession-playbackposition.md) - [OH_AVSession](capi-ohavsession-oh-avsession.md) - 错误码 - [媒体会话管理错误码](errorcode-avsession.md)